Web1 de mar. de 2024 · Howard Pyle, (born March 5, 1853, Wilmington, Del., U.S.—died Nov. 9, 1911, Florence), American illustrator, painter, and author, best known for the children’s books that he wrote and illustrated. Pyle studied at the Art Students’ League, New York City, and first attracted attention by his line drawings after the style of Albrecht Dürer. Web17 de set. de 2011 · As a teacher of illustration from 1894 to 1905, Howard Pyle (1853-1911) inspired the careers of both young and seasoned illustrators. This exhibition examined Pyle’s teaching methods, which honed the skills of Jessie Willcox Smith, Thornton Oakley, Frank Schoonover, N.C. Howard Pyle made this monotone oil painting in an early phase of his career. It was part of the process of creating an illustration for Thomas Wentworth Higginson’s article, “The Second War of Independence.”.
